Blue Hills, CT has 14 charging locations on the federal register, offering 57 ports between them — the 28th largest count in Connecticut.
Only 8.8% of ports here are DC fast. Most of the capacity is Level 2, which suits workplaces, hotels and apartment parking rather than a quick stop mid-journey.
7 different charging networks operate in Blue Hills, CT, which in practice means carrying more than one app or card.

About this data
Data comes from the Alternative Fuels Data Center's public station register. It covers publicly reported charging infrastructure; home chargers and unreported private installations do not appear. Port counts describe configured capacity, not live availability.
